From the Temple Daily Telegram, Temple, Texas, Friday, March 9, 1973:

OBITUARIES

MRS. BALCH

Funeral for Mrs. Laura Louella Balch, 94, of 905 S. 33rd St., will be at 2 p.m. Friday at Harper-Talasek Funeral Home, the Rev. Bob Briles officiating. Burial will be in Bellwood Memorial Park.

Mrs. Balch died Wednesday night in a Temple Hospital. She had been ill for several months.

She was born in Calvert, the daughter of Joseph and Mattie Hunter, who were early settlers in the Calvert community. She was married to Vinnett O. Balch, Aug. 21, 1897. They lived in Battle for several years before moving to West Texas near Merkel. Mr. Balch died in 1910. She moved to Temple in 1919. She was a member of the Seventh Street Methodist Church and was active in church work until a few years ago.

Surviving are a son, Robert l. (Bob) Balch of Temple; four daughters, Mrs. W. C. Banzhaf and Mrs. L. W. Moore, both of Temple; Mrs. Mary O'neill of Galveston and Mrs. George V. Tucker of Killeen; five grandchildren and six great-grandchildren.

Pallbearers will be George Banzhaf, Glen Banzhaf, Eddy Moore, James Peddcard, John Lusk Jr. and Charles Fischer.

From the Temple Daily Telegram, Temple, Texas, April 10, 1978:

OBITUARIES

ROBERT L. BALCH

Funeral for Robert L. Balch, 78, of 205 Yuma, will be today at 2 p.m. in Harper-Talasek Funeral Home with the Rev. William Winston officiating. Burial will be in Bellwood Memorial Park.

Mr. Balch died late Saturday afternoon in a local nursing home after a long illness.

Mr. Balch was born in Merkel and came to Temple in 1918 where he operated a battery business. He retired after 25 years in business and then worked for the John Lusk Real Estate Company until several years ago.

He was in the Army during World War I and was a charter member of the American Legion.

Survivors are his sister, Mrs. Frances Tucker, Mrs. L. W. Moore and Mrs. C. W. Banzhaf, all of Temple and Mrs. Mary O'Neal of Galveston.
